* Added new attribute types Short and unsigned short.
* Adaptation to use doubles instead of ZnReal for calls to Tcl_GetDoubleFromObj. * (RotateItem): Added a flag to choose between degrees and radians. * (ScaleItem): Added an optional scale center * Added conditional inclusion of overlap manager include
